Tooling Technician Details:

  • Direct Hire position
  • $27.00 to $32.00 /hour
  • Second Shift (Monday through Friday from 03:00pm to 11:00pm)
  • Responsible for building, repairing, maintaining, and troubleshooting a variety of tools, dies, fixtures, and gauges.
  • Supports production through precision repairs, preventative maintenance, and tool modifications to ensure equipment runs efficiently and safely.
  • Repair, maintain, and assemble all types of dies, jigs, fixtures, and tooling
  • Perform inspections using micrometers, calipers, and other precision measuring equipment
  • Read and interpret blueprints, cooling diagrams, and work instructions
  • Clean, polish, and inspect die cavities and surfaces
  • Replace or repair ejector and punch pins; check and repair water lines and fittings
  • Weld (MIG, TIG, Stick) components as needed
  • Prepare dies and cavities for shipment or external vendor repair
  • Work safely on hot molds (300–600°F) with proper PPE
  • Maintain good documentation of repairs and follow quality standards
  • Assist with troubleshooting and maintaining pneumatic and low-voltage electrical circuits
  • Collaborate with maintenance, set-up, and production personnel as needed
  • Follow company safety policies and maintain a clean, organized work area
  • Other duties as assigned

Tooling Technician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ma or GED (preferred)
  • Minimum 3 years’ experience in Tool & Die or similar trade (preferred)
  • Technical training in blueprint reading, shop math, and machine operation (preferred)
  • Proficiency in blueprint reading and print interpretation
  • Ability to work from verbal, written, or visual instructions
  • Familiar with hand tools, bench tools, grinders, saws, tube benders, etc.
  • Basic welding and machining knowledge
  • Ability to read tape measure to 1/32" and document results
  • Familiarity with gauges, layouts, and dimensional troubleshooting
  • Forklift and overhead crane operation experience (certifications preferred)
  • Basic computer skills (data entry, repair logs)
